A Prolific Career Rooted in Deep Faith: Neta Jackson

Neta Jackson, renowned across America for her captivating Christian fiction, historical fiction, and non-fiction narratives, has a unique life story as compelling as her books. Born to a Christian school dealer, Neta’s childhood was a whirlwind adventure, traversing the length and breadth of the United States before putting down roots in Seattle.

Heralded as a prodigious reader from a young age, Neta honed her storytelling prowess when a short narrative she penned about a mountain lion won first place in a Scholastic Magazine contest during her senior year of high school. A new typewriter, purchased with her prize money, set the stage for her journey into the literary world.

Neta’s versatile pen has conjured up several widely acclaimed series, including the Trailblazer series and the Yada Yada Prayer Group series. Her personal life is closely interwoven with her literary journey, as she often collaborates on various projects with her husband and fellow author, Dave Jackson.

Neta Jackson’s debut in the publishing world happened in grand style in 1983 with the release of her non-fiction book, New Way to Live. However, her first stride into the realm of fiction happened in 1991, opening up new avenues for her literary prowess.
